JG Music Therapy offers services to children ages 4-17

who have needs including:

 

  • Psychiatric/Psychological
  • Mental
  • Behavioral
  • Physical/Rehabilitative
  • Developmental
  • Emotional

 

... and other special needs and disorders

 

 

 

 


 


 

 

 Session activities may include, but are not limited to, playing instruments, lyrical analysis, music improvisation, musical games, musical stories, music and imagery, music performance, receptive listening, music and movement, and song writing.

    What to expect ...

     

    • Initial sessions (assessment sessions) will be used to assess your child's capabilities, characteristics, needs, etc.

     

     

    • When the Music Therapy Assessment is completed, I will develop a Music Therapy Treatment Plan for your child. The Music Therapy Treatment Plan will reflect findings from the assessment as well as outline specific goals and objectives for your child

     

    • You, the parent/guardian, and I will then meet to go over the Music Therapy Treatment Plan so that you can know what we are working on in our sessions

     

     

    • Remaining sessions (referred to as "treatment sessions" will be dedicated to working on the goals and objectives outlined in your child's Music Therapy Treatment Plan

     

     

     

    • In addition to the informal verbal updates that I give fairly often, I typically provide documented Progress Updates once or twice a year.

     

     

     

    • Progress Updates may be sent (by me) to applicable persons, endowments, charities, etc. who have provided funding to you for your child to receive Music Therapy services. They love updates, and it's encouraging for them to see how their generousity is helping your child!

     

     

     

     

     

     

     

     In addition ... 

     

     

     

    I also often consult my client's school IEP, teachers, and/or the child's parent/guardian regarding concepts that are being taught in your child's class so that I may incorporate, when possible, some of the same concepts in your child's MT treatment sessions. I find that consistency, repetition,and reinforcement are important when working with children who have special needs.
